Abstract
- Single-cell RNA sequencing has emerged as a powerful technique for the identification of distinct cell states/populations in complex tissues. We have recently used this technology to investigate heterogeneity of cells of the oligodendrocyte lineage in the mouse central nervous system. In this chapter, we describe methods to perform single-cell RNA sequencing on this glial cell lineage, and discuss experimental and computational approaches to explore the potential and to tackle hurdles associated with this technology.
